IPoE-server interface client-subnet looks broken or works with the wrong logic.
To reproduce:
set service ipoe-server gateway-address '100.64.0.0/28' set service ipoe-server interface eth1 client-subnet '100.64.0.0/28' set service ipoe-server interface eth1 network 'shared' vyos@r4# commit [ service ipoe-server ] Local auth mode requires local client-ip-pool or client-ipv6-pool to be configured! [[service ipoe-server]] failed Commit failed